City of Oak Creek
Common Council Report
Meeting Date: January 15, 2008
Item No.:
Recommendation: That the Common Council approve the recommendation of the Street Superintendent to purchase one (1) 2008 20-yard rubbish truck from Stepp Equipment in the amount of $120,095.00, minus $6,000.00, for a total of $114,095.00.
Background: The Street Department advertised for bids for a current model 20-yard Rubbish Truck. The new garbage truck will replace a 1991 International with 112,750 miles and rusting out in several locations, including the sides of the box and the sides and rails in the rear hopper. The bid from Stepp Equipment was the lowest of the bids that met all of the specifications; they will also give the city $6,000.00 for a trade in of the 1991 International Garbage truck. This new truck will be used for special pick-ups; spring and fall clean up; it will also be placed in the recycling yard and used for larger items that are brought in by residents. The new truck will also be equipped with a tipper mounted on the rear of the hopper enabling us to dump the residential carts in the event of mechanical problems with any of the side loading garbage trucks and the holiday extra pickups. We received a total of nine (9) bids from four different vendors.

Fiscal Impact: $125,000.00 was budgeted in the 2008 CEP fund for the purchase of this garbage truck. The awarded bid was $114.095.00 with the trade in producing a savings of $10,905.00. This money will be returned to the CEP fund.
